Backyard Chicken Company Experiencing Soaring Sales Due to Increased Egg Prices

Retrieved on: 
Monday, January 23, 2023

BROOKS, Ga., Jan. 23, 2023 /PRNewswire/ -- Following the widespread Avian Flu outbreak and increased price of eggs in the US, mypetchicken.com has seen record-breaking sales numbers in January 2023, trending 2-3 times over last year with no signs of slowing down. A growing concern about food security is the primary driving factor behind first-time customers purchasing backyard chickens. Experienced chicken keepers are also adding to their flocks to increase egg production, and meet demand for their communities.

The Worldwide Off-Highway Vehicle Telematics Industry is Expected to Reach $1 Billion by 2028 - ResearchAndMarkets.com

Retrieved on: 
Monday, March 21, 2022

The global off-highway vehicle telematics market was valued at US$ 754.44 million in 2020 and is expected to reach US$ 1,166.96 million by 2028; it is estimated to register a CAGR of 5.9% during the forecast period.

  • Telematics hardware and software solutions for remote monitoring and management of fleets of machinery and equipment used in these industries are called off-highway vehicle telematics.
  • By using off-highway vehicle (OHV) telematics devices that allow GPS, cellular, or satellite connectivity for access to real-time equipment data, off-highway vehicle telematics solutions offer continuous monitoring of the position, condition, health, and utilization of equipment.
